3. Wenshu Monastery

Wenshu Monastery is one of the oldest and largest Buddhist temples in Chengdu and one of the must-see attractions in Chengdu. This temple was built in 618 AD and has a long history and profound cultural heritage. In Wenshu Monastery, you can admire exquisite Buddha statues and murals and feel the peaceful and peaceful atmosphere. In addition, there are many interesting cultural activities here, such as Buddhist lectures and meditation experiences, allowing you to better understand Buddhist culture.

4. Qingcheng Mountain

Qingcheng Mountain is located in the northwest of Chengdu. It is a tourist attraction with the theme of natural scenery and Taoist culture. It has magnificent landscapes and rich plant resources, and is known as the "Switzerland of the East". You can hike here and enjoy the magnificent mountains and waterfalls, as well as visit ancient Taoist temples and temples. If you are interested in hiking, Qingcheng Mountain is also a good choice.
